Report Reveals Human Error in Fire Response

with No Comments

  Interesting that multiple calls reporting the fire were dismissed. The same thing happened with the Freeway Complex Fire when area residents reported a second fire in Brea (not Corona). We hope the Orange County Fire Authority and California Highway Patrol train their personnel to respond according to protocol, so this doesn’t happen again. And, that they track red flag days better than they did for this fire. Check out the Orange County Register article.

Outside Investigation Sought for Canyon Fire 2

with No Comments

Many of the projects Hills For Everyone is involved with are at the Wildland Urban Interface. These locations are particularly difficult to defend, especially when Santa Ana Winds are a factor. It is helpful to have OCFA take this approach–an outside investigation–and review of its responses to the #CanyonFire2. While they may need to approach things differently, our elected leaders need to consider the impacts of having more houses farther out in the wildland areas–especially in known fire corridors.
